Actually we don't have that much customers from Australia.
In my experience it is impossible to predict the delivery times to Australia.
We ship all packages as DHL Premium only (which means priority shipping by air)
But some packages are delivered within 7 days, some within 4-5 weeks. DHL says they start an investigation if the the package is not delivered in the course of 8 week. However no one package was lost before.

We are thinking about opening a warehouse (storage and distribution) in Australia (and USA). This would solve the problem with uncertain delivery times.
If wel see a bit more activity and interest from oversea clients, we are going to do it in 5-6 months.
